Chia-Yu Hsu is a scholar working on Atmospheric Science, Control and Systems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Chia-Yu Hsu has authored 19 papers receiving a total of 398 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Atmospheric Science, 4 papers in Control and Systems Engineering and 3 papers in Electrical and Electronic Engineering. Recurrent topics in Chia-Yu Hsu’s work include Adaptive Control of Nonlinear Systems (3 papers), Cryospheric studies and observations (3 papers) and Automated Road and Building Extraction (3 papers). Chia-Yu Hsu is often cited by papers focused on Adaptive Control of Nonlinear Systems (3 papers), Cryospheric studies and observations (3 papers) and Automated Road and Building Extraction (3 papers). Chia-Yu Hsu collaborates with scholars based in United States, Taiwan and China. Chia-Yu Hsu's co-authors include Wenwen Li, Sizhe Wang, Avis H. Cohen, Eric Tytell, Megan C. Leftwich, Boyce E. Griffith, Christina Hamlet, Alexander J. Smits, Lisa Fauci and Chih‐Min Lin and has published in prestigious journals such as Journal of Alloys and Compounds, Remote Sensing and International Journal of Production Research.
